"I have been the means, under God, of haanging a great number, but never such a disjaskit rascal as yourself"

Edmund Joseph Sullivan
1869-1933

"I have been the means, under God, of haanging a great number, but never such a disjaskit rascal as yourself"

1927
14 11/16 x 10 7/16 inches (373 x 265 mm)
Black ink over graphite, on illustration board.
1986.1484

Bequest of Gordon N. Ray, 1987.

Notes
Caption title.
Original drawing for an illustration for Robert Louis Stevenson's unfinished novel "Weir of Hermiston," published in, Weir of Hermiston. The misadventures of John Nicholson. London : Macmillan, 1928.
Inscriptions/Markings
Inscribed and dated at lower right, "Edmund J. Sullivan 1927"; inscribed in pen at bottom, "Weir of Hermiston. (p. 24) 'I have been the means, under God, of haanging a great number, but never such a disjaskit rascal as yourself.'"
